Sentiment 68.0%
as of Sep 12, 2026
Positive drivers
Robust demand for ASML's EUV systems continued from leading AI chipmakers including TSMC and Samsung, supporting record order backlogs through August 2026. Positive analyst upgrades followed strong bookings data and successful High-NA EUV pilot shipments. Expansion of production capacity in the Netherlands and US further reinforced growth outlook.
Neutral / mixed
Geopolitical export controls on China remained a managed risk with limited immediate revenue impact due to diversified customer base. Broader semiconductor cycle volatility led to mixed short-term forecasts from some banks. Currency headwinds from euro strength were offset by pricing adjustments.
Negative drivers
Delays in full-scale High-NA EUV adoption by some foundries raised questions on near-term revenue timing. Rising competition in advanced packaging and alternative lithography approaches created minor overhang. Macroeconomic concerns over potential AI capex slowdown weighed on valuation multiples.
Bottom line
Sentiment stayed moderately positive on ASML's entrenched position in the AI supply chain despite execution and macro risks. The 30-day window reflected steady institutional buying balanced by cautious positioning ahead of upcoming earnings.
